Hey, i'm in north Carolina. I'm 23, recent eye injury resulting in loss of peripheral vision and extremely low visual acuity. So, I have been released to go back to work full duty with no restrictions but I am still blind in my left eye. it has only been three months since I've been outta work. My question now is, will this mess up my set[/i]tlement now that I am released to work with no restrictions?

As far as settlement you should have been given an impairment rating when placed at MMI... As far as returning to work, is there any restrictions? I don't personally think this will affect your settlement when you do get it but in the w/c world you never know..

The w/c world is totally different than any other.. But like I said you should be fine thats pretty much their way of saying you're not disabled and all resources have been "exhausted"
